The DeKalb County Department of Watershed Management provides programs and services that support commercial development while protecting the integrity of the county’s water and sewer systems.

This page includes information on capacity allocation, capacity credits, capacity assurance, and the Fats, Oils,
and Grease (FOG) program, which helps businesses operate responsibly and remain in compliance with county regulations. These services are designed to promote sustainable growth, system reliability, and clear guidance for the business community.

Pretreatment Program

The Pretreatment Program protects our treatment systems and the environment.

Services:

  • Industrial wastewater permits
  • Self-monitoring requirements
  • Compliance inspections
  • Technical assistance

FOG Managements (Fats, Oils and Grease)

This program is required for food service establishments.

Program Elements:

  • Grease interceptor inspections
  • Compliance monitoring
  • Education and training
  • Permitting assistance
